Attach handle to vacuum

1.

Locate handle and remove screw packet

taped to the base of the handle.

2.

Stand the vacuum upright and place the

base of the handle firmly into the grooves

at the top of the vacuum body.

3.

Insert the two (2) screws into the existing

holes on each side and tighten securely.

Attach vacuum hose and tools

1.

Line up tabs on the base of the Twist

‘n Snap™ hose with the corresponding

notches on the hose collar. Turn the hose

to the right to lock into place.

2.

Grasp the Quick Reach handle and slide

the end of the hose into the hose wand

base. Snap the hose into the upper hose

clip on handle.

3.

Slide the extension wand and crevice tool

together into storage clip.

4.

Snap the combination tool into the

storage clip.

Select models only:

5.

The TurboBrush® Tool bracket slides into

the front of the handle. Attach the bracket

by aligning the pegs with the holes on

the handle and pulling down until it locks

into place.

6.

Place the TurboBrush® Tool in the bracket

by aligning the bottom of bracket with

the opening of the brush roll and snap

the TurboBrush® Tool into place.

Tip:

Hold onto the plastic hose
collar while installing. It may
be easier to lock the hose into
place when the hose handle is
not yet inserted into the base
of the unit.
